We are seeking a Senior Experience Designer to join our major mobile game studio client. This role leads the effort to create user-centered solutions that promote ease of use, employ best-in-class game/interaction design, and optimize the user experience universally in response to user testing. The responsibilities range from running other UX/UI staff and leading all phases of the design process, including conceptual design/development, graphic and interface design, interaction models, prototypes, user/task flows, and implementation in the game engine.
